The cheapest way to get from Toronto to Belgrade Lakes is to fly and drive which costs $55 - $270 and takes 5h 38m.
The fastest way to get from Toronto to Belgrade Lakes is to fly and taxi which takes 5h 31m and costs $130 - $320.
No, there is no direct bus from Toronto to Belgrade Lakes. However, there are services departing from Toronto and arriving at Colby College Museum of Art via Buffalo and Boston, MA - South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 18h 41m.
The distance between Toronto and Belgrade Lakes is 633 miles. The road distance is 566.7 miles.
The best way to get from Toronto to Belgrade Lakes without a car is to bus which takes 18h 41m and costs $140 - $260.
It takes approximately 6h 47m to get from Toronto to Belgrade Lakes, including transfers.
